+# README for the itrans package, 5.32
+
+ Version 5.32, of the itrans package
+ (Supports Devanagari, Gujarati, Telugu, Kannada, Bengali, Tamil,
+ Punjabi, and Romanized Sanskrit)
+ -----------------------------------------------------
+ http://www.aczoom.com/itrans/
+ -----------------------------------------------------
+
+This is a package for printing text in Indian language scripts.
+
+This package only does the transliteration mapping, the fonts
+may be developed elsewhere.

+ITRANS is distributed in the following archives:
+
+ [required]
+ itransNN.zip - ITRANS source code (Unix format) in a ZIP archive
+ - also includes binary for MS-DOS
+ - includes docs in .itx (ITRANS) format
+ itransfn.zip - fonts for use with ITRANS
+ iupdateN.zip - Updates to itransNN.zip [when needed]
+
+ [pre-compiled binary archives, includes fonts for use with ITRANS]
+ itransNN-i386.tgz - for i386 Linux platforms (tested on Slackware)
+ itransNN-win32.zip - for Win32 (Windows 95/NT or newer)
+
+ [optional]
+ itransht.zip - docs in HTML (using Ross Moore's Latex2HTML for ITRANS)
+ itransps.zip - docs in PostScript format, for printing.

+Directories & Files (all directories have README files with more info):
+
+src/ ITRANS source code, and makefiles.
+ Also includes binary for Linux (ELF) and MS-DOS.
+
+INSTALL.unix Installation instructions for ITRANS on Unix systems.
+INSTALL.pc Installation instructions for ITRANS on DOS/Win systems.
+
+TRANS.TXT Quick review of the ITRANS encoding table.
+
+CHANGES list of changes between consecutive released ITRANS versions.
+
+lib/fonts All fonts used by ITRANS.
+
+lib/fonts/README List all font files in lib/fonts and their uses.
+
+itrans.lst, itransps.lst, itransht.lst, itransfn.lst
+ List of files in the respective ITRANS archives
+
+lib/ Input files that define char composition - the *.ifm files.
+ Also contains examples of environment variables needed,
+ dvipsrc scripts, etc.
+
+doc/ ITRANS documentation.
+
+doc/idoc.itx The main ITRANS manual
+ (all docs also available in PostScript and HTML formats).
+
+doc/ex_*.itx Example input files, for LaTeX, HTML, Unicode, etc output.
+
+contrib/ Additional files and tools that may be useful.
